Balmoral Is One Of The Best Restaurants In Illinois
Delicious food isn’t hard to find around the Prairie State, especially in our cities. And in Campton Hills, part of Chicagoland, is where you’ll find what could arguably be called one of the best restaurants in Illinois. Balmoral Restaurant not only has an incredible menu but a unique ambiance that can’t be beaten. Balmoral Restaurant is named after Balmoral Castle in Scotland. So, yes, this is a restaurant that features Scottish cuisine....